Gerald Fenwick Metcalfe (fl.1890-1930)
Study for the war memorial at Albury, Surrey
signed 'GERALD/METCALFE' (lower left within a cartouche) and extensively inscribed with dedications and dated '1913/1914' (centre)
pencil and watercolour heightened with touches of bodycolour
19¼ x 13½ in. (49 x 34.3 cm.)

Lot Essay

This cartoon is finished and coloured to a degree that allows it to stand alone as a decorative object. Metcalfe worked as a professional portrait painter and exhibited eleven works at the Royal Academy. However, the care he invested in this design is evident from the beauty of its construction.

Metcalfe's Vindemia, an allegorical design, sold at Sotheby's New York, 29 October 2002, lot 119.
